James Forshaw

19 Jan 2026
Obituaries

It is with sadness that we share the passing of James Forshaw, a former English teacher at Glenalmond College and a valued member of our wider community, on the 2nd of January 2026.

James was a kind and much-loved husband, father, brother, grandfather, father-in-law, friend and teacher. He had a deep appreciation for English literature and music- from the poetry of Seamus Heaney to the songs of The Rolling Stones- and he brought enthusiasm to every aspect of life. A keen supporter of rugby, James loved the outdoors and enjoyed dog walks, camping expeditions, songwriting, plays and concerts.

He touched the lives of many during his time at Glenalmond and beyond, and he will be greatly missed.

James is survived by his wife Frances and his children Marianne and Thomas.

A service to honour James’s life will take place at St Mary’s Scottish Episcopal Church, Birnam at 2.00pm on Thursday 29 January. All are welcome.
